❄️ Understanding the Camera Shutter Mechanism
The camera shutter is a complex mechanism responsible for controlling the amount of time the camera’s sensor is exposed to light. Whether it’s a mechanical or electronic shutter, its precise operation is vital for proper exposure. This precision can be compromised by extremely low temperatures.
Mechanical shutters use physical blades or curtains to open and close, while electronic shutters use the camera’s sensor to start and stop the exposure. Both types are susceptible to the effects of cold.
🌡️ The Science Behind Cold Weather’s Impact
⚙️ Viscosity of Lubricants
Many camera shutters, especially mechanical ones, rely on lubricants to ensure smooth and fast operation. In cold weather, these lubricants can become more viscous, hindering the movement of the shutter blades or curtains. This increased viscosity slows down the shutter response time.
This slower response can lead to overexposure, blurry images, or even a complete failure of the shutter to operate correctly.
🔋 Battery Performance
Cold temperatures significantly reduce battery performance. Cameras rely on batteries to power the shutter mechanism, and a weakened battery can struggle to provide the necessary power for a quick and consistent shutter response. This is more pronounced in older batteries.
A cold battery might deliver inconsistent power, leading to unpredictable shutter speeds and unreliable performance. Keeping batteries warm is crucial.
🗜️ Material Contraction
Different materials within the camera’s shutter mechanism contract at different rates in cold weather. This differential contraction can cause parts to bind or misalign, affecting the shutter’s timing and accuracy. This can lead to significant problems.
Such misalignment can result in uneven exposure across the frame or even prevent the shutter from opening or closing completely. Maintaining a stable temperature can help prevent this.
📸 Practical Effects on Photography
🐌 Slowed Shutter Speeds
The most noticeable effect of cold weather is a decrease in shutter speed. What should be a 1/250th of a second exposure might actually be 1/125th or slower, resulting in overexposed images if not compensated for.
This is especially problematic when shooting action or in situations where a fast shutter speed is necessary to freeze motion. Adjusting your settings is key.
🌫️ Inconsistent Exposures
The variability in shutter response can lead to inconsistent exposures from shot to shot. One image might be perfectly exposed, while the next is significantly brighter or darker. This inconsistency makes post-processing more difficult.
Careful monitoring of your camera’s metering and making manual adjustments can help mitigate this issue.
🚫 Shutter Failure
In extreme cases, the shutter can completely fail to operate. This can manifest as a shutter that refuses to open, a shutter that sticks open, or a shutter that operates erratically. This can render the camera unusable.
Preventive measures, such as keeping the camera warm, are essential to avoid this scenario. Regular maintenance is also important.
🛡️ Tips for Protecting Your Camera in Cold Weather
♨️ Keep Your Camera Warm
The simplest and most effective way to combat the effects of cold weather is to keep your camera warm. Store it inside your coat or in a camera bag with hand warmers when not in use. This helps maintain a more stable temperature.
Consider using a camera rain cover or a specialized cold-weather camera bag for added insulation and protection from moisture.
🔋 Use Fresh Batteries and Keep Them Warm
Use fresh, fully charged batteries, as they perform better in cold conditions. Keep spare batteries in an inside pocket to keep them warm. Rotate batteries frequently to ensure they are all functioning optimally.
Consider using external battery packs that can be kept warm separately from the camera body.
⏱️ Allow Time for Adjustment
When moving from a warm environment to a cold one, give your camera time to adjust to the temperature change before using it. This allows the internal components to acclimatize gradually, reducing the risk of sudden failure.
Sudden temperature changes can also cause condensation, which can damage electronic components. A gradual transition minimizes this risk.
⚙️ Regular Maintenance
Regularly inspect and maintain your camera’s shutter mechanism. If you anticipate shooting in cold weather frequently, consider having your camera serviced by a professional to ensure the shutter is properly lubricated with cold-weather-compatible lubricants.
Proper maintenance can significantly extend the lifespan and reliability of your camera, especially in challenging conditions.
🧤 Use Camera Gloves
Wear gloves designed for photographers that allow you to operate the camera’s controls while keeping your hands warm. Cold hands can make it difficult to adjust settings and operate the shutter release smoothly.
Look for gloves with touchscreen compatibility if your camera has a touchscreen interface.
🌬️ Protect from Moisture
Cold weather often brings snow and ice, which can melt and damage your camera. Use a waterproof camera bag and lens cloths to keep your equipment dry. Consider using silica gel packets inside your camera bag to absorb moisture.
Avoid bringing your camera directly from a cold environment into a warm one, as this can cause condensation to form inside the camera. Allow it to warm up gradually.
❓ Frequently Asked Questions
What is the ideal temperature range for camera shutter operation?
Most cameras are designed to operate optimally within a temperature range of 0°C to 40°C (32°F to 104°F). Extreme temperatures outside this range can affect shutter performance.
Can cold weather permanently damage my camera shutter?
Yes, prolonged exposure to extremely cold temperatures can cause permanent damage to the shutter mechanism, especially if the lubricants freeze or components misalign. Prevention is key.
Does the type of camera (DSLR vs. Mirrorless) affect shutter response in cold weather?
Both DSLR and mirrorless cameras can be affected by cold weather, but the specific effects may vary. DSLRs with mechanical shutters are more susceptible to lubricant viscosity issues, while mirrorless cameras with electronic shutters may be more affected by battery performance.
How do I know if my camera shutter is being affected by cold weather?
Signs of cold weather affecting your shutter include slower shutter speeds, inconsistent exposures, unusual noises from the shutter mechanism, or the shutter failing to operate altogether. Test your camera before relying on it.
Are some camera brands more resistant to cold weather than others?
While some manufacturers may use different materials or designs that offer slightly better cold-weather performance, all cameras are susceptible to the effects of extreme temperatures. Following the recommended precautions is essential regardless of the brand.
